Published in two parts, in 1605 and 1615, don quixote is the most influential work of literature from the spanish golden age and the entire spanish literary canon. The book cover and spine above and the images which follow were not part of the original ormsby translationthey are taken from the 1880 edition of j. It tells the story of an aging man who, his head bemused by reading chivalric romances, sets out with his squire, sancho panza, to seek adventure.
